Steps to Guide the Students for November Intake in Australia
Here is the detailed guide for you to let you know how to apply for the November Intake in Australia.
Step 1: Start Your Research of Courses and Universities Early
The first and most important step towards admission is research. Start your research as early as January. Make a list of the universities that offer your desired courses for the November intake. In this Intake, not all universities offer programs and degrees, so you should contact the best study abroad consultants.
While researching, keep the following things in mind:
- Course availability
- Entry requirements
- Tuition fees
- Scholarships
- Location and living expenses
Step 2: Shortlist the Universities and Courses
Once you have done your research for the university and course, you must shortlist 3 to 5 universities that match your interests and academic background. Look for courses that match your career goals and passion. Also, check what the requirements are for the course and the university.
Some of the top universities in Australia that may offer November intake programs include:
- University of Southern Queensland
- Charles Darwin University
- Federation University
- Torrens University
- Some TAFE institutions
Step 3: Take English Language Tests (March to May 2025)
To study in Australia, you need to prove your English language. So you must clear the English Proficiency test to prove your ability. The English Language Tests you should clear are:
- IELTS
- TOEFL
- PTE Academic
- Cambridge English Test
It is a good idea to take these tests early, as you will need time to prepare for the exams.
Step 4: Prepare and Submit Applications (May to July 2025)
After completing your English tests, you can now begin the application filling process. Visit the university website or apply through an official admission portal or an authorized study partner. You will usually need to submit these documents while applying:
- Academic transcripts
- Statement of Purpose (SOP)
- Letters of Recommendation
- Resume or CV
- Test scores
- Passport copy
Make sure to write a strong SOP, which enhances your profile and increases the chances of selection. It should clearly explain why you want to study that course at that university, and how it will help you in your career.
Step 5: Apply for Scholarships (If Available)
Many Australian universities offer scholarship options for international students. This financial aid can reduce your tuition fees or even cover your entire cost of study. Must check if your chosen university is offering a scholarship for the November intake and apply early, as seats are limited for the scholarships.
Step 6: Receive the Offer Letter and Accept It (August 2025)
If the university accepts your application. After selection, you will receive the offer letter. Read it properly. If everything looks good, then go for it by accepting the offer, signing it, and paying the required deposit fee. Some universities may ask you to give an interview before admission, so prepare yourself accordingly.
Step 7: Apply for the Student Visa (August to September 2025)
After accepting the offer from the university, apply for an Australian student visa. For this, you will need to prepare these documents before applying:
- Confirmation of Enrolment (CoE)
- OSHC (Overseas Student Health Cover)
- Proof of funds
- Valid passport
- English test results
Apply for the visa online through the official Australian immigration website.
Step 8: Plan Your Travel and Accommodation to Fly to Australia
Once your visa is approved, it’s time to plan your travel to Australia. Book your flight tickets early to get cheaper rates. Arrange for all accommodation, which you can select either on campus or off campus. Also, make sure that you attend the pre-departure sessions organized by the university.
Now you are totally ready to start your new education journey in Australia. Reach in a few days early before the course starts. This will give you little time to settle down, adjust yourself, and get comfortable in your new surroundings.
